Located in Keighley, Steeton Primary School is a primary school, serving pupils aged 4 to 11. The school is a community school and operates as a mixed school. It follows a not applicable admissions policy. It does not have a designated religious character, which may suit families looking for a non-faith school.

Steeton Primary School currently has around 275 pupils on roll, which is about 87% of its capacity. The gender split is relatively balanced, with approximately 53.1% boys and 46.9% girls. Around 26.5%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, which gives an indication of the socio-economic mix. Pupil backgrounds are varied across different backgrounds and needs.

Overall absence at the school is 6%. Persistent absence is recorded at 19.8%.

Pupil backgrounds are varied, with white british pupils forming the largest group at around 40.4%. pakistani pupils make up about 36.4%

Safeguarding was judged to be effective, which is a key consideration for many parents.
